A commitment to quality starts where in the organization?
The commitment to quality begins with a company's top management.
Each plant should have a written QA program. What is this program called and
what are the minimum items to be addressed by it.
Minimum items to be addressed by the QSM are:
-Management commitment
-Definition of organization structure
-Management review of the QA program
-Plant facilities layout and definition
-Purchasing procedures for QC compliance
-Uniform methods for reporting, reviewing, and maintaining records
-identification of training needs
-Control, calibration, and paintenance of necessary equipment
-Standards for shop drawings to ensure accuracy and uniform interpretation of
instructions for manufacturing handling
-Procedures for review and dissemination of project-specific requirements to production
and quality control personell.
There are several categories of shop drawings. Definte at least two types.
Categories of shop drawings:
-ERECTION DRAWINGS: Show an overall layout of products for a particular area. May
be a wall layout (elevation) for architerctural concrete cladding panels or a plan layout
for double-tee floor members in a garage
-INDIVIDUAL PIECE DRAWINGS (Shop Ticket): Piece drawings are prepared to detail
the internal reinforcement to be cast in a particular unit. Also shown are embedded
items and connection assemblies.
